An investigation on neutron induced reactions on stable CNO isotopes

2014 
The neutron induced reactions on stable Carbon,Nitrogen,and Oxygen isotopes are investigated by using the Talysl.4 toolkit with the default parameters.The neutron incident energy covers a range from 0.20 MeV to85.00 MeV.Forl2C and14N,the Talysl.4 results agree with the experimental data,while the parameters should be adjusted forl6O.Some E?windows are found by comparing the main channels of n+C/N/O reactions,which induce element change.In these En windows,a specific element is activated to a different one while leaving the other element atoms unchanged.The results will facilitate the research of doping effects in organic materials by using neutron activation technique.
